Output 58830f2ab39fcef6d3dc56082c6302ee016ce55421d421d0a9429391d7d93eae:5

value
6591
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 eb47bea7e3f76e90ba511e44e1e58c52c7b5ffd6ecb2dd5d729153bcb6266c68
address
bc1padrmaflr7ahfpwj3rezwrevv2trmtl7kajed6htjj9fmed3xd35q5fq6l5
transaction
58830f2ab39fcef6d3dc56082c6302ee016ce55421d421d0a9429391d7d93eae
spent
true